Ordinary Bitter

Ordinary Bitters are gold to copper colored. Chill haze is allowable at cold temperatures. Fruity-ester and very low diacetyl aromas are acceptable, but should be minimized. Hop aroma may be evident at the brewer�s discretion. Low to medium residual malt sweetness is present. Hop flavor may be evident at the brewer�s discretion. Hop bitterness is medium. Mild carbonation traditionally characterizes draft-cask versions, but in bottled versions, a slight increase in carbon dioxide content is acceptable. Fruity-ester and very low diacetyl flavors are acceptable, but should be minimized in this form of bitter. Body is low to medium. English and American hop character may be specified in subcategories.
